I recently picked these fake nails up from sasa.com for $5.10. I loved the look of them, they reminded me of that japanese style Hime Gyaru which means "princess gal" If I could pull that style off I swear I would dress like that everyday. Its so cute! Im content with small & more subtle variations of it though. If you are unfamiliar with this style, click here for a link to some google images of it

This set comes with 24 nails and no glue. The sizing is kind of weird, I would have to file these down for them to fit perfectly on my nails. I realize now that buying these nails was a complete a waste of money! Where the heck am I gonna wear this? I need to find some tea or princess party ASAP! This is not the kind of shit to rock wearing a t-shirt and sweat pants. I feel like I would have to be in a full on princess costume for these nails to make any kind of sense. Oh well, at least their nice to look at lol, they were only 5 bucks anyway, maybe Ill wear them halloween.
